1. TradeSanta — Best for Simple Rule-Based Automation

TradeSanta is a cloud-based trading bot platform built for traders who want to automate DCA and grid strategies without writing code.

It runs 24/7 on Binance, Bittrex, Kraken, Huobi, OKX, and other major exchanges. Importantly, articles on the TradeSanta site discuss AI themes, but core features revolve around rule-based bots and indicator signals rather than model-driven predictions, making it honest automation rather than overstated AI.

2. Coinrule — Best for Strategy Diversity Without Coding

Crypto Technical Analysis Bot

Coinrule offers a no-code rule builder with over 150 pre-designed strategies for traders who want flexibility without programming.

Coinrule provides a library of over 150 pre-designed strategies, ranging from simple buy/sell rules to complicated strategies based on technical indicators like Bollinger Bands and golden crosses.

Source: NFTEvening, March 2026. It integrates with 10+ exchanges including Binance, BitMEX, Bittrex, and Kraken.

5. HaasOnline — Best for Custom Scripting and Advanced Strategy Building

HaasOnline is built for experienced traders who want full control through code. Its proprietary scripting language, HaasScript, allows custom bot creation with extensive libraries for building complex strategies.

It supports 15+ exchanges and includes comprehensive backtesting on historical data making it the most technically capable platform on this list for traders comfortable with scripting.

6. Pionex — Best Free Crypto Bot With Built-In Technical Strategy Tools (New Entry)

Pionex is a crypto exchange with 16 built-in trading bots available at no additional cost — the most accessible free bot option on this list.

Pionex is notable for integrated bot access. Source: Coinspot.io, May 2026.

Its grid trading, DCA, TWAP, and martingale bots are all built directly into the exchange, meaning there’s no third-party platform to connect.

Pionex charges a flat 0.05% trading fee with no additional bot fees.

What Makes a Good Crypto Technical Analysis Bot?

Not all bots do the same thing. Before choosing, it helps to know the difference between the two main categories:

Rule-based bots follow your instructions precisely: If RSI drops below 30 AND volume exceeds X, buy.

They execute your strategy automatically without interpreting the market themselves. TradeSanta, Coinrule, Pionex, and 3Commas fall here.

They’re reliable and transparent; you know exactly what they’ll do.

AI-assisted bots use machine learning or pattern recognition to adapt to market conditions. AI trading bots represent a quantum leap beyond traditional algorithmic trading.

While conventional bots follow rigid rules, AI-powered platforms utilize machine learning algorithms that adapt to changing markets.

Cryptohopper’s marketplace signals and HaasOnline’s advanced scripting approach this territory, though most platforms in this list are primarily rule-based.

The indicator combination that works best in bots (2026):
According to Troniex Technologies (March 2026):

  • RSI + MACD: best for confirming trends
  • Bollinger Bands + Volume Indicators: best for identifying breakouts
  • EMA + Fibonacci: best for swing trading setups

These combinations are what the most effective TA bots use as trigger conditions for entries and exits.
